Aquinas sees all creation carrying the mark of creativity, as a result of “issues had been made like God not solely in being but in addition in appearing.” Moreover, “the dignity of causality is imparted even to creatures.”
Sure! And to a particular diploma, the human creature has been blessed with this “dignity of causality.” Will we really feel such dignity? Or can we take it as a right, wallowing as an alternative in emotions of powerlessness or victimhood?
In my ebook Creativity: The place the Divine and the Human Meet, I suggest that creativity is the very definition employed by anthropologists for our species. We’re bipeds who make issues. Our languages and music and extra are profoundly artistic and various.
Based on Aquinas, the human mind can “conceive an infinite variety of issues to be able to make for ourselves an infinite variety of devices.” We make an “infinite selection” of meals, modes of transportation, communication, leisure, weapons, clothes, and different requirements of life as a result of we’re endowed “with each cause and our palms.”
Our intellects are huge and open and free—they’ve a type that’s not decided to 1 factor alone, as is the case with a stone, however have a capability for all varieties. It’s wonderful that Aquinas repeats the phrase infinite so readily when he’s describing who we’re. We’re nearly infinite in our artistic capacities.
Sadly, we have to be on guard, for our powers of alternative and creativity may deliver evil into the world. We aren’t pre-programmed to do the great. We should work at that. The unjust individual is worse than injustice and the evil individual worse than a brute, as a result of an evil individual can do ten thousand occasions extra hurt than a beast, as a result of we are able to use our cause to plot many various evils.
Thus our creativity is a double-edged sword. We will do fantastic and superior issues with it—and we are able to do evil and terrible issues. The selection is ours to make. That alternative is the very which means of morality.
